Downtown Sendai

Downtown Sendai bustles with energy as northern Japan's economic heart. Explore the sprawling Ichibancho shopping arcade or hunt for treasures at Asaichi Morning Market. Kokubuncho's narrow alleys light up at night with glowing lanterns and lively izakayas. The massive Sendai Station provides excellent connectivity with bullet trains and local transit options. Discover regional specialties like Sendai beef and zunda (edamame paste) in restaurants ranging from casual ramen shops to upscale dining. Department stores and covered arcades offer year-round shopping regardless of weather.

Aoba Ward

Aoba Ward blends ancient and modern Japan with its hilltop castle ruins and downtown energy. The tree-lined streets earned this Sendai neighborhood its name, which means "green leaves" in Japanese. Historic sites reveal glimpses of samurai history throughout the district. Walking paths connect tranquil spaces like Nishi Park and Aobayama Botanical Garden with the bustling commercial hub. Hot springs offer relaxation after exploring museums and shrines. The excellent subway system makes it easy to visit both cultural landmarks and shopping arcades.

Kokubuncho

Kokubuncho pulses with energy as Sendai's premier nightlife district. Over 2,000 bars, clubs, and izakayas line neon-lit alleyways where red lanterns create a mesmerizing atmosphere. Traditional wooden facades house sake bars while modern karaoke boxes glow from upper floors. The district showcases authentic Japanese social customs with minimal tourist pandering. Most venues operate until 2 AM weekdays and 5 AM weekends. Tokyo Electron Hall Miyagi sits nearby, and Kotodai-Koen Station provides easy access for exploring this vibrant entertainment zone.

Ichibancho

Ichibancho sits at the heart of Sendai, where sleek office towers mix with the buzz of the covered shopping arcade. Business travelers and shoppers alike flock to this central district. The neighborhood connects easily to Sendai Station for quick city explorations. The pedestrian-friendly Ichibancho Shopping Arcade offers everything from upscale boutiques to traditional stores. Nearby restaurants serve local specialties like Sendai beef and zunda. After work hours, the area transforms with business professionals filling the many bars and eateries.

Explore the Date Masamune mausoleum at Zuihoden, where ancient cedar trees surround the ornate final resting place of Sendai's founding lord. Savor the city's famous grilled beef tongue at restaurants near the station, then visit Matsushima Bay's pine-covered islands for one of Japan's most celebrated scenic views.

Best time to go to Sendai

The best time to visit Sendai is dependent on what kind of holiday you are seeking. August is its hottest month on average. At this time, visitor numbers are average and weather is mostly sunny with light rain. January is its coolest month on average. At this time, visitor numbers are average and weather is mostly sunny with light rain.

calendarCalendar MonthtemperatureTemperaturerainPrecipitationmostlyCloudinessoccupationOccupancypricePricing
January34.2°F (1.2°C)Light RainMostly SunnyAverageSlightly Low
February34.9°F (1.6°C)No RainMostly SunnyAverageAverage
March41.9°F (5.5°C)Light RainMostly SunnyAverageSlightly Low
April50.4°F (10.2°C)Light RainMostly SunnySlightly HighAverage
May60.1°F (15.6°C)Light RainMostly SunnyAverageSlightly High
June66.6°F (19.2°C)Light RainMostly SunnyAverageSlightly Low
July73.9°F (23.3°C)Light RainMostly CloudySlightly HighAverage
August76.5°F (24.7°C)Light RainMostly SunnyAverageSlightly High
September70.3°F (21.3°C)Moderate RainMostly SunnySlightly HighSlightly High
October60.1°F (15.6°C)Light RainMostly SunnySlightly LowAverage
November50.2°F (10.1°C)Light RainMostly SunnySlightly LowAverage
December39.6°F (4.2°C)Light RainMostly SunnySlightly LowAverage

The nearest major airports for your trip to Sendai

When visiting Sendai, you can fly into two major airports. Sendai Airport (SDJ) is approximately 16.1km from the city centre, with nearby accommodation options such as the 4.5-star The Westin Sendai, and the 4-star Almont Hotel Sendai and Hotel Metropolitan Sendai, all located 14.5km from SDJ. Alternatively, Yamagata Airport (GAJ) lies about 214.5km away, with good hotels like the 3.5-star Takinoyu Hotel, just 6.4km from GAJ, offering convenient transportation services such as 24-hour airport shuttles. Other options include Hotel Metropolitan Yamagata and Yamagata Nanokamachi Washington Hotel, both located 17.7km from Yamagata Airport.

What's the weather like in Sendai?
The hottest months are usually August and July with an average temp of 72°F, while the coldest months are February and January with an average of 38°F. The rainiest months in Sendai are September, August, July, and October, with each month seeing an average of 8 inches of rainfall.
